Important Fitment & Licensing Notes
-
Supported tuning platform: HP Tuners.
-
PCM unlock / upgrade: Applicable 2019+ FCA/Stellantis HEMI vehicles require a compatible PCM unlock or upgrade before tuning.
-
Smart Access Cable: Applicable 2019+ Dodge, Jeep, Chrysler, and Ram vehicles require the HP Tuners Smart Access Cable for vehicle communication.
-
HP Tuners licensing: Most of the supported HEMI ECM applications in this group are listed at 2 HP Tuners credits. Credits are separate from The Tune Shop tuning service.
-
Additional credits may be required when transmission tuning or another controller is being tuned.
-
Exact requirements should be confirmed by year, model, engine, VIN, and controller before ordering.
-
2025–2026 applications: Tuning availability must be confirmed before purchase when the specific vehicle/controller is not yet listed as supported by the selected tuning platform.
